Cyberpunk 2077

Something to do other than missions

I genuinely enjoyed this game overall. The story was fantastic and gripped me in many areas. However, while the city was very immersive the activities really weren't there. I went to many bars and clubs hoping to do something other than people watch, but alas it wasn't there. I believe there is one club with an interactive dance floor, but I don't remember seeing any other. From a story driven point, I loved the main story. It may have been too high an expectation, but I genuinely thought there would be more to do with the npcs. I went through 2 of the romance options, and I enjoyed the part of getting there and developing Vs story along with theirs. It just felt like after you unlocked a special cutscene that was pretty much it. You couldn't call them to discuss anything new (with an exception or two). None of the npcs were really able to be interacted with outside of missions. This to me felt disappointing. Maybe it wasn't in CDPR's original vision or scope, but I feel that would help immerse oneself in a big city like this. It is surprising to see this massive open city where the characters come to life but aside from people watching, there wasn't much else to do outside of story/side missions. Overall, I feel this game was good especially the story telling, but they missed the mark on features that feel like they should be there. It just feels like there are features that should be in this game and aren't.
